系统管理/系统设置相关接口/SNMP相关接口
PUTSNMP起始版本 4.10.0同步需要认证
更新SNMP代理
更新SNMP代理
调试可用性
在线调试
使用当前认证信息和示例参数提交 Mock 请求。
请求参数
请求体字段
updatesnmpagentObject必填updatesnmpagent 请求体结构
uuidString必填资源的UUID,唯一标示该资源
versionString必填SNMP代理使用协议版本
readCommunityString读团体字(version为v2c时使用)
userNameString用户名(version为v3时使用)
authAlgorithmString认证算法
authPasswordString认证密码
privacyAlgorithmString隐私算法
privacyPasswordString隐私密码
portint必填端口
systemTagsList系统标签
userTagsList用户标签
响应状态
请求地址
PUT/zstack/v1/snmp/agent/actions
/zstack/v1/snmp/agent/actions
请求示例
curl -X PUT 'http://{host}/zstack/v1/snmp/agent/actions' -H 'Authorization: OAuth {sessionUuid}' -H 'Content-Type: application/json;charset=UTF-8' -d '{"updatesnmpagent":{"uuid":"<uuid>","version":"<version>","readCommunity":"<readCommunity>","userName":"<userName>","authAlgorithm":"<authAlgorithm>","authPassword":"<authPassword>","privacyAlgorithm":"<privacyAlgorithm>","privacyPassword":"<privacyPassword>","port":1},"systemTags":["<systemTags>"],"userTags":["<userTags>"]}'
响应示例
200{ "inventory": { "uuid": "cad9965ebedd495aa1f5718f31da1aa8", "version": "v3", "userName": "zstack", "authAlgorithm": "SHA", "authPassword": "authPassword", "privacyAlgorithm": "AES128", "privacyPassword": "privPassword", "port": 162 } }变更历史
此 API 暂无变更历史记录。
